Hey new folks — quick ticket context. The Burrowmint quota service on staging was reading the prod tenant map, so every staging tenant got prod-sized rate limits and our load tests looked suspiciously great. We've repointed QUOTA_MAP_URL to staging, but the quota service can't authenticate to the staging map store yet. Fix is to add the store's access secret to the service .env, directly below this sentence.

vault entry, yajop-bafop: ARCHIVE_KEY3=8d4

## Dependency Pinning Policy

Plugins published to the Marleth Extension Registry must pin all direct dependencies to exact versions. Floating ranges are rejected at upload time, and transitive overrides are capped per manifest. These limits exist to keep resolver time bounded during review builds. The enforced quotas are defined by the following constants.

tuning constants:
BUDGETS = {
    "druath": 240,
    "lamwyn": 180,
    "silael": 275,
}

Quick capacity note on the Larkspool reset-flow revamp: the new token service fans out to plugin hooks synchronously, so your handlers now sit on the hot path. We sized for roughly 3x current peak, assuming hooks return fast. If yours does network calls, budget carefully or you'll trip the breaker. Here are the limits we're provisioning against, straight from config:

tuning table, yajog-yahof:
BUDGETS = {
    "lamvan": 303,
    "wenox": 460,
    "fenvan": 525,
}